Default LS460L Plus Zero Tire Size

New here, sorry if this has been covered. 2007 LS460L has 235/50R-18 Bridgestone Verenza, actually 29K. Ready to purchase Either Michelin Pilot Sport A/S Plus, Michelin Pilot HX MXM4, or Bridgestone Turanza Serenity.
Has anyone tried the plus zero 255/45ZR Pilot Sport A/S Plus on the LS460. I am interested in any difference in ride or noise level?
